Eligibility requirements for the post of Governor is specified in which article of the Constitution?

QuestionEligibility requirements for the post of Governor is specified in which article of the Constitution?
Typemultiple_choice
OptionArticle 152 and 157incorrect
OptionArticle 157 and 159incorrect
OptionArticle 157 and 158correct
OptionArticle 156 and 158incorrect
SolutionThe eligibility criteria for the position of Governor are outlined in Article 157 and 158 of the Constitution. The powers vested in the Governor are delineated in Article 167C, Article 200, Article 213, and Article 355.
